【发布时间】:2023-12-15 02:07:01
【问题描述】:
我可以在刀片中使用下面定义一个变量
<?php $var = var1 - var2; ?>
然后打印为
{{ $var }}
但是如何使用 laravel Blade 模板方法设置变量然后使用它,基本上是 5.2 中的 @set 替代?
【问题讨论】:
-
按照你说的方式,用php标签。但是你不能在你的控制器里面做吗?
-
是的,我们可以做到这一点,但是您知道在刀片模板中设置变量而不使用 php 标签的方法吗?
-
为什么不在控制器中做这些事情,我猜控制器是用于所有计算/操作的东西,而视图仅用于显示输出。
-
@Hirendrasinh S. Rathod : 再次是的,我们可以做到这一点,但你知道在刀片模板中设置变量而不使用 php 标签的方法吗?
-
不,对不起,我没有,你应该尝试在 laracast 论坛上问这个问题。
标签: php laravel templates laravel-5.2 laravel-blade